Kevin Diesel owns the Fredonia Barber Shop. He employs 5 barbers and pays each a base salary of $1,440 per month. One of the barbers serves as the manager and receives an extra $565 per month. In addition to the base salary, each barber also receives a commission of $8.50 per haircut. Other costs are as follows. Advertising $250 per month Rent $1,100 per month Barber supplies $0.35 per haircut Utilities $150 per month plus $0.15 per haircut Magazines $35 per month Kevin currently charges $15.00 per haircut. Determine the unit variable costs per haircut and the total monthly fixed costs. (Round variable coststo 2 decimal places, e.g. 2.25.)
